TRAC's 2018 Rubber Recycling Symposium set for Nov. 7-8

    NIAGARA FALLS, Ontario—"Taking Sustainability to the Next Level" is the theme of the 2018 Rubber Recycling Symposium scheduled for the Sheraton on the Falls Hotel in Niagara Falls Nov. 7-8.

    The Tire & Rubber Association of Canada is sponsoring the symposium in collaboration with the U.S. Tire Manufacturers Association and eTracks Tire Management System, according to a TRAC press release issued April 10.

    The biennial TRAC Rubber Recycling Symposiums bring together international experts from tire and rubber manufacturing, rubber recycling, government and academia, the association said.

    The Nov. 7 agenda will include:

    • A global overview of sustainability initiatives in tire recycling;
    • The future of sustainability in tire manufacturing;
    • Tire stewardship in Ontario—transition to individual producer responsibility; and
    • The search for sustainable markets.

    The Nov. 8 agenda will include:

    • A tire industry product update;
    • Tire stewardship in Ontario—industry response to individual producer responsibility; and
    • A panel of industry CEOs offering their insights into the challenges and opportunities presented by individual producer responsibility and the search for sustainable markets.

    The registration fee for the symposium is $495 Canadian per person. To register or find additional information visit tracanada.ca.
